Strobl, Carolin; Wickelmaier, Florian; Zeileis, Achim – Journal of Educational and Behavioral Statistics, 2011
The preference scaling of a group of subjects may not be homogeneous, but different groups of subjects with certain characteristics may show different preference scalings, each of which can be derived from paired comparisons by means of the Bradley-Terry model.
